THREE local riders will be competing in the 2017 Master of Midshires Grasstrack Racing event next month.

Wickhamford’s Tim Nobes, Offenham’s Scott Cresswell and Littleton’s Dave Meadows are gearing up for the competition at Victory Field, near Ashorne, Warwickshire, on Sunday, July 9.

There will be more than 45 races with practice starting at 10.30am and tapes up for the first race at 12.30pm.

Many of the country’s speedway stars, including Mark Baseby, Steve Boxall, Rob Mear, Ben Barker, Lee Smart, Zach Wajknecht, Tom Perry and James Wright, are in this year’s 500cc solo class.

Among the 30 outstanding 500cc starters are regular grasstrack aces David Howe, Paul Cooper and Ben Millichap who will be looking to make the top step of the podium.

Other classes include 250cc, 350cc and right solos, 500cc sidecars and 1,000cc sidecars.

Jed Collins returns to see whether he can make it a hat-trick in the 250 but will face stiff opposition from David Knowles, Charlie Brooks and Plymouth speedway youngster Henry Atkins.

The day will also include the second round of the super series of 500cc sidecars with 12 crews racing.
